Marks Electrical Group, the Leicester-based online electrical retailer, has seen continued growth in its first half.
According to an update for the six months ended 30 September 2023 (HY24), a strong trading period has seen revenue growth of 24.8% to £53.9m, up from £43.1m in the same period last year.
The business saw continued market share gains in the Major Domestic Appliance and Consumer Electronics markets, and rapid growth in its premium next-day service offerings with integrated, gas, electric and television installation services achieving over 7,000 installation orders in the first half, against 2,500 in the prior year, and over 11,000 freestanding connection services against 5,000 last year.
Robust performance was seen across product categories with particularly high growth in televisions (+71%), washer-dryers (+74%) and American fridge-freezers (+36%).
Mark Smithson, Chief Executive Officer, said: “We’ve built on the good momentum delivered at the start FY24, with revenue growth of 24.8% against a Major Domestic Appliances & Consumer Electronics market that is broadly flat in the first half of our financial year.
“Our strategic decision to add in-house installation services to our offering has strengthened the Group’s premium service proposition, enabling us to develop a market leading installation offering, growing market share and driving revenue growth.
“The launch of this service, alongside the well documented industry-wide pressures regarding wage inflation, impacted our H1 margin, with the pressure on distribution and installation costs being higher than expected. At the same time, year on year, we remained disciplined on marketing costs, maintained our cost control on overheads and are continuing to gain market share profitably.
“We remain focused on our full year targets and expect margin pressure to ease in H2 as we benefit from improved operating leverage during the peak trading period.
